Retailers invest over £5m into Derbion as centre prepares for busy end to 2024
18th September 2024 A number of long-term retailers at Derbion have invested over £5m into the centre during the first half of 2024, as the Derby scheme gears up for a busy end to the year. Several retailers have invested in store upgrades, fitouts, upsizes, and relocations at the scheme, meaning that retailers have committed a total of £35.6m into Derbion since 2021. The latest £5.2m chunk of investment will see a number of retailers increase upsize at the centre. This includes JD Sports – which will be growing the size of its space to 20,175 sq ft – and Superdrug, which is set to increase the size of its space by 1,872 sq ft to 10,431 sq ft. Greggs has also increased its space to 2,015 sq ft to allow more customers to eat in. This year, Derbion has also secured new lease agreements with Ann Summers, New Look, The Perfume Shop, and Quiz, all of which have recommitted their futures to the centre. Ann Summers relocated to its new space in May, whilst the other three retailers are set to move to their new locations at Derbion over the next few months.
